For me its gonna be a pro charger d1x of which i will be ordering next week. I like Ease of installation (no cutting), the ease of returning it back to stock. if the belt breaks you can still drive home. I like the location of the head unit. I like Sound of the straight cut gears..also the maf sensor location gives a cleaner less sparratic signal to the ecu for better drivability. My previous car was a paxton s197 car it was a good set up!

Did you read this part of the paxton/vortech owners manual:

In order to achieve the low noise level of Paxton
Superchargers , Paxton specifies manufacturing procedures that call for minumum internal clearance. These precise tolerances however are not conducive to temperatures below 25°F. Therefore , storing the vehicle in a heated garage and/or
employing the use of an engine block
heater/aftermarket engine blanket is required when the vehicle is subjected to a " cold start up " in ambient temperatures below 25 degrees F. Failure to comply with this may result
In immediate supercharger failure and invalidate the
Supercharger warranty.
